In a community solar setup, a large solar array is installed in a suitable location, such as an open field or a rooftop, with optimal sunlight exposure. The solar panels in the array generate electricity, which is then fed into the local power grid.
While it varies from home to home, US households typically need between 10 and 20 solar panels to fully offset how much electricity they use throughout the year.

Quick Answer: Solar panels typically last 25-30 years with gradual performance decline, but many continue producing electricity for 40+ years. Understanding their lifespan is crucial for calculating your return on investment and making informed decisions about this significant home.
